摘要
A computer program has been developed in C Language under UNIX environment for bituminous mix design by Marshall method. The design values for each parameter are calculated from the best-fit curve based on least squares principles. The program also gives comparative results in tabular form, which show the variation between the observed and estimated values for various design parameters corresponding to the bitumen content of the samples. It is a very powerful tool considering enough knowledge of designer for design of bituminous mix in no time without going for manual calculations, approximations and tedious works for different type of constructions under different conditions/ situations where mix design is required. This package does not give any indication regarding the changes if desired values are not achieved as per specification such as material types, grading quality of binder and filler materials.
